A girl once dreamed a kingdom into existence—and paid for it with her identity. Years after being institutionalized and stripped of her imagination, Claire Balstam discovers the truth: the worlds she and others created are real, and Drifthaven was never meant to cure them, but to harvest their power. As control tightens and her mind fractures under engineered nightmares, Claire must choose—submit to the story written for her, or reclaim her name, her voice, and the Dreamworld she was born to create…even if it costs her everything.

A prince was born into a kingdom of sugar and steel—and raised to hold it together. As it begins to fracture, Elias senses a threat no sword can meet—shifting borders, vanishing structures, and a darkness that does not follow the rules of his world. At the center of it all is Marie—a girl who does not belong, yet feels inextricably tied to everything he is trying to protect. As the truth behind the Dreamworlds begins to surface, Elias must confront what he cannot understand: that his world may not exist without her—and that saving it may mean losing the one person who makes it real.

When a brilliant young clockmaker breaks time to save his dying brother, he unleashes a shadow that begins to consume imagination itself—and binds his own life to mending what he has undone. As he moves through worlds born of belief—guiding, failing, and learning the cost of interference—he discovers that true restoration cannot be forced, only chosen. But when the first Dreamer is captured and her memory erased, threatening to unravel every world she created, he must risk everything to reach her—trusting that even broken time can still be set right… if someone remembers how to believe.
